Before: Anchor and online pos, wait until sov3 kicks in
Anyone who has been playing eve smart has multiple stashes. For the same reason that I always park my jumpfreighter in highsec after doing logistics for the alliance instead of docking in 0.0, I started to make small stashes all over Eve. In case my alliance gets disbanded, I'm prepared with combat ships in npc 0.0 and empire. Should my home station in 0.0 fall into enemy hands before I can evac I will still have combat ships in the other stations. In a game where you can lose stuff very easily, you never put all your eggs in one basket. I even have mining and mission running ships fully fitted in empire, just in case. Malcanis and me aren't the only people doing this, i expect anyone living in 0.0 to have multiple backup plans for anything that could happen. |

The Sov changes will open up 0.0 to a decent amount of players that want to work (rent space) from bigger alliances but other than that I don't see a drastic change in how space is held atm. You have to understand the pilots that have held space for years (the active ones anyway) will still hold sway over the most profitable areas of 0.0. How will you stop a thousand+ Capital fleet if your a newb in 0.0 with your hundred + casual 0.0 carebear corp? you can't. Nothing CCP will do will change that. Why should they anyway? Most of those guys worked thier ass off for that space. This xpac gives more players the chance to Join the big boys and work thier space with them, not take em over. It's been said before and I say it again: Nothing will change. So we don't have sov anymore in a system? What does that mean? That you can go there and claim it? Nope. We still own it. You go there, you die. Simple as that. This does not increase the alliances that will hold and claim 0.0 space. It will only mean that you no longer see systems owned by sov holding alliances as claimed which they still deem their turf. Will that open the door for "noobs" into 0.0 alliances? No. as it has been said before as well, if you can't pull your weight we don't need you. Simple as that. Are you worth 200+m a month? If not, why bother signing you up? Because you can fly a ship? Well, that essentially just means that you cost the enemy a salvo of T2 ammo. I'd label that a meatshield if anything. A roll of armor is cheaper, though, because it doesn't whine for a new ship when it gets hammered, so take a wild guess what we will prefer. Fewer systems will be "claimed", but mining/scanning will still be done in unclaimed but "owned" systems. Alliances will strip down the "claimed" systems, that's a given. What they don't need claimed will not be claimed. That does neither mean that this will be for the taking (nothing in EvE is free, not even death) nor does it mean that sov holding alliances suddenly see any need for 5m SP noobs. |
